The President of Iran is dead. The President of Iran Ebrahim Raisi, Foreign Minister Hossein Amirabdollahian, and several other high-ranking representatives of the Iranian authorities were killed in a helicopter crash near Jolfa in the Iranian province of East Azerbaijan - the Iranian Red Crescent informed on Monday morning. After several hours of searching, the services reached the site of the helicopter crash, on which among others, the President of Iran, Ebrahim Raisi, and the head of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of the country were flying. "No signs of living passengers of the helicopter were found" - it was reported.
